Summary
Oliver Middle School is a public middle school located in Broken Arrow, Oklahoma, serving grades 6-8 with a total enrollment of 937 students. The school is part of the Broken Arrow School District, which is ranked 211 out of 452 districts in Oklahoma and is rated 3 stars out of 5 by SchoolDigger.
Oliver Middle School has consistently underperformed compared to the Broken Arrow district and the state of Oklahoma in standardized test scores across all grades and subjects. For example, in the 2024-2025 school year, the school's proficiency rates in English Language Arts (23%) and Mathematics (17%) were significantly lower than the Broken Arrow district (28% and 26%, respectively) and the state (26% and 26%, respectively). However, the school's performance in Science is relatively better, with 34% of students proficient or better, compared to the Broken Arrow district (30%) and the state (30%). Oliver Middle School's performance has been declining over the years, with its statewide ranking dropping from 92 out of 297 Oklahoma middle schools in 2014-2015 to 193 out of 369 in 2024-2025.
The school has shown mixed performance across different student subgroups. It has performed relatively well for Hispanic and English Language Learner students, ranking in the top 25-80 out of 122 and 84 Oklahoma middle schools, respectively, in the 2024-2025 school year. However, the school has struggled with Native American, White, Multi-racial, and Special Education students, ranking in the bottom half or bottom quarter of Oklahoma middle schools for these subgroups. Additionally, Oliver Middle School has consistently high chronic absenteeism rates, ranging from 17.9% to 22.4% over the past few years, which are higher than the district and state averages. The percentage of students receiving free or reduced-price lunch at the school has been increasing, from 35.25% in 2021-2022 to 50.91% in 2023-2024, indicating a growing population of economically disadvantaged students.
